Renal function tests (or renal panel) are a series of tests that examine how well the kidneys are working in removing waste products (urea, toxins, uric acid) and extra water from the blood (urine) and ensuring proper balance of key chemical elements such as sodium, potassium, calcium, etc. They also are essential in …
